How much does it cost to dorm at Manhattan College?
Dining and housing costs at Manhattan are bundled together. In 2019 – 2020 students typically paid $16,870 for cost of living.

How much is the deposit for Manhattan College?
To officially enroll, you must submit a $100 non-refundable enrollment deposit. This enrollment deposit is required in order to reserve a space in your classes and will offset a portion of your registration fees for the first semester.

Can you go to college for free in New York?
Under this groundbreaking program, more than 940,000 middle-class families and individuals making up to $125,000 per year will qualify to attend college tuition-free at all CUNY and SUNY two- and four-year colleges in New York State. The new program begins in the fall of 2017 and will be phased in over three years.
